In the United States and Canada, they're frequently referred to as roof specialists or roof experts. The most common roofing material in the United States is asphalt tiles.


In the USA, the fatal injury rate in 2021 was 59.0 per 100,000 full-time roofing contractors, compared to the nationwide standard of 3.6 per 100,000 full time workers.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, roof covering has actually been within the leading 5 highest fatality rates of any career for over one decade in a row.


More than half a million individuals annually are treated for fall from ladder and over 3000 individuals pass away consequently. In 2014 the approximated expense annual price of ladder injuries, including time far from job, medical, lawful, obligation expenses was approximated to reach $24 billion. Male, Hispanic, older, independent workers and those that operate in smaller facilities, and work doing construction, upkeep, and repair service experience higher ladder loss injury rates when compared to ladies and non-Hispanic whites and persons of various other races/ethnicities.

European regulations established minimum standards for health and wellness and are shifted right into regulation in all Member States. In the United States, OSHA requirements need companies to have numerous methods of autumn security readily available to make certain the safety of workers. In building and construction, this puts on employees that are exposed to falls of 6 feet or more over reduced degrees.


Some states leave roof covering regulation as much as city-level, county-level, and municipal-level jurisdictions. Unlicensed contracting of projects worth over a set threshold may result in stiff fines or even time in jail. In some states, roofing contractors are needed to meet insurance coverage and roof permit guidelines. Roofing professionals are likewise needed to show their permit number on their marketing material.

In 2009, in response to high rates of drops in buildings the Japanese Occupational Safety And Security and Health Rules and Guidelines changed their details policies. In 2013 compliance was reduced and the need for further research study and countermeasures for preventing falls and making sure fall security from elevations was determined. The UK has no legislation in position that calls for a roofing contractor to have a permit to trade, although some do come from identified trade organizations.

The PFAS includes an anchorage, connectors, body harness and may consist of a lanyard, slowdown tool, lifeline or appropriate combination of these (https://yamap.com/users/4805714). Beyond these compulsory parts of the PFAS, there are also particular autumn ranges connected with the performance of the apprehension system. Specifically, there is a total fall distance that the PFAS need to enable to aid the employee in avoiding contact with the ground or other surface below




Along with the autumn distance needs for each and every component of the PFAS, the anchorage of the PFAS should also be able to sustain a minimal 5,000 pounds per employee. The complimentary fall range, to the distance that the employee drops before the PFAS starts to work and slows down the rate of the autumn, should be 6 feet or much less, nor contact any kind of lower degree

The D-ring change, the distance that the harness stretches and exactly how far the D-ring itself moves when it experiences the full weight of the worker throughout a loss, is usually thought to be 1 foot, relying on the devices style and the producer of the harness. For the back D-ring height, the range in between the D-ring and the sole of the worker's shoes, companies frequently utilize 5 feet as the standard elevation with the presumption that the employee will certainly be 6 feet in elevation, however since the D-ring height variability can influence the safety and security of the system, the back D-ring height must be calculated based upon the actual height of the employee.

An autumn restriction system is a type of fall protection system where, the goal is to quit employees from reaching the unguarded sides or edges of a workspace in which a loss can subsequently take place. This system serves where an employee may shed their footing near an unguarded side or start gliding.

Fall restraint systems are not clearly specified or mentioned in OSHA's autumn security criteria for construction, they are permitted by OSHA as defined in an OSHA letter of interpretation last updated in 2004. OSHA does not have any type of details requirements for autumn restriction systems, but recommends that any type of autumn restriction system be qualified of withstanding 3,000 pounds or at the very least twice the maximum anticipated pressure needed to save the worker from being up to the lower surface.


Caution lines are easy systems that permit for a perimeter to be formed around the working location to make sure that employees know dangerous sides. Caution lines are just allowed on roof coverings with a low slope (having an incline of much less than or equivalent to 4 inches of upright increase for each 12 inches horizontal length (4:12)).
